Petworth House and Park | West Sussex | National Trust | Visit the 17th-century house, with parkland landscaped by 'Capability' Brown. Home to paintings and sculpture, including work by Turner and Van Dyck.

It's just a normal car park that you drive around one way. There is quite a bit of space because obviously it is one of the main car parks visitors use to visit Petworth House. It is a pay and display machine car park, so be prepared to pay, or if you're a member of the National Trust, then it is free.It is right next to the main road that on the opposite side has a great kids play park to go to. This is very good as Petworth doesn't seem to have anything for children, so this is quite a handy thing for young families.The car park is also right next to the Visitor Reception area for Petworth and all important toilets. As well as being a visitor reception area, it also seems to double as a shop/garden shop. I'm not sure how that works, but it's there if people want to buy it.

We parked here so that we could visit Petworth House. It's about 8-10 minutes walk to the house along a lovely path through the woods. Buggy access is available from the National Trust car park to the house. It's also a convenient spot to park if walking through the parkland.
